Subject: Re: [pve-devel] [PATCH storage] Revert "workaround zfs create -V error for unaligned sizes"

On 6/14/23 13:38, Thomas Lamprecht wrote:
> Am 14/06/2023 um 13:28 schrieb Aaron Lauterer:
>> This reverts commit cdef3abb25984c369571626b38f97f92a0a2fd15.
>>
>> The bug should be fixed by now [0]. The reproducer doesn't cause any
>> issues in my tests.
>>
>> [0] https://github.com/openzfs/zfs/issues/8541
>
> hmm, torn on this one; 1 MB aligned images sound not to bad for various things,
> and the extra size is rather negligible most of the time so we can mostly lose
> here, otoh. it should be callers decision if storage works fine now..
>
>>
>> Signed-off-by: Aaron Lauterer <a.lauterer@proxmox.com>
>> ---
>> AFAICT this has an affect on EFI disks which after this revert will be
>> 528k and not 1M. Similar as if we would store it as a .raw file.
>>
>
> that sounds like it _could_ break stuff..
>
> @fiona: what was the state with local storage migration and those disk size
> mismatches? Or anything else coming to your mind?
I did a few tests in the meantime. An EFI disk on a directory based storage will
be 528 K and can be moved to a ZFS storage with this patch. Without it, it will
fail, similar to RBD which needs a 1M min size IIRC.
